PJ Library, a program of the Harold Grinspoon Foundation in partnership with local Jewish communities, aims to make resources for families celebrating the fall holidays easily accessible and readable for all ages. Their expanded 2021 fall version is called “A Time to Grow: A PJ Library Family Guide to the Fall Holidays.” Overflowing with activities, recipes, rituals, playlists, music videos, podcasts, and more, it’s sure to make Rosh Hashanah and Yom Kippur even more exciting.

With a focus on breaking down the meaning of each holiday, the traditions behind them, and their origins, PJ Library has collected all of the best resources and organized them in a way for kids to be able to engage with the content online. The free, downloadable guide is available on their website and is also friendly for iPad and mobile use.
